Neither White nor Williams’ office have commented on subpoenas from Murrill’s defense attorneys that were signed Tuesday by Robert Chaisson, a retired state appeals court judge appointed to oversee the case against Murrill after all 12 criminal court judges recused.
The subpoenas direct Williams and White to surrender records by 5 p.m. Friday, as Murrill’s attorneys aim to root out the origins of the grand jury’s interest in Murrill.
Along with any correspondence involving the grand jury, Roche, Murrill or the charges she faces, her attorneys want Williams to turn over communication with Moreno, City Council President JP Morrell, former Congressman Cedric Richmond, state Sen. Gary Carter or news media.
